Emerging Trends in Sexual Relationships
1. The Increase in “Herbivore Men”
One notable shift within the demographic landscape of Japan is the emergence of “herbivore men” (soshokukei danshi). These men are characterized by their passive approach to relationships, often exhibiting a disinterest in aggressive romantic pursuits traditionally expected of men. Instead, they seek emotional connections rather than physical intimacy.
A 2019 study by the Japan Family Planning Association indicates that 61% of men aged 18-34 identify as herbivore men, preferring to engage in hobbies or casual dating rather than pursuing serious relationships. This trend can be attributed to sociocultural factors, including economic pressures, career anxieties, and the fear of commitment fostered by a rapidly changing society.

3. Changing Family Dynamics and Attitudes Toward Marriage
Japanese society has traditionally placed emphasis on marriage and family. However, recent years have seen a rise in non-traditional family structures, including single-parent households and cohabitation without marriage. A 2021 survey by the Japan Institute for Labor Policy and Training revealed that 30% of millennials are choosing to remain single or cohabit without tying the knot.
This transformation reflects a broader acceptance of diverse lifestyles and the acknowledgment that family can take on various forms. Men and women are increasingly choosing to prioritize personal fulfillment over societal expectations, consequently reshaping long-held beliefs about relationships with implications for sexual dynamics.
